我在SharePoint中使用了一些自定义WebPart,如(http://www.codeplex.com/smartpart)和一些控件。我在不同的页面上有多个WebPart。如何将它们链接在一起?例如,在按钮单击事件处理程序或超链接目标应该是要导航到的URL?
答案 0 :(得分:1)
在SharePoint中连接Web部件通常是通过在它们之间传输数据来完成的。例如,单击一个Web部件中的项可以在另一个Web部件中提供更多详细信息。以下是Office web site的示例。通过使用Web部件标题栏上的控件将Web部件连接在一起来配置Web部件。
有许多开发自己的例子。 Here is one我发现这些内容非常详细,如果您搜索consumer producer connected web part
,还有很多其他内容。
编辑:无法访问其他已连接网络部件中的控件(感谢kusek)。解决方案是分析来自其他Web部件的数据并相应地更改行为。